Early Life and Education
Alfred Marie-Jeanne was born on November 15, 1936, in Rivière-Pilote, a small town in Martinique, France. Growing up in a politically active family, he was exposed to the world of politics from a young age. He attended local schools in Martinique before pursuing higher education in France.

Rise to Prominence
In 1998, Marie-Jeanne was elected President of the Regional Council of Martinique, a position he held for over a decade. During his tenure, he implemented various policies aimed at promoting economic development and cultural preservation in Martinique.
